lathai.blogg.se

Aida 32 bit
Aida 32 bit







aida 32 bit

Its absence also prevents 64-bit Windows prior to Windows 8.1 from having a user-mode address space larger than 8 terabytes. Without CMPXCHG16B one must use workarounds, such as a critical section or alternative lock-free approaches. This is useful for parallel algorithms that use compare and swap on data larger than the size of a pointer, common in lock-free and wait-free algorithms. Similar to CMPXCHG8B, CMPXCHG16B allows for atomic operations on octal words.

aida 32 bit

Early AMD64 processors lacked the CMPXCHG16B instruction, which is an extension of the CMPXCHG8B instruction present on most post-80486 processors.See also: How prevalent are old 圆4 processors lacking the cmpxchg16b instruction? This instruction may also be referred to as CompareExchange128. It is supported on all modern x86-64 processors, although some early AMD64 CPUs did not support it. The CMPXCHG16B instruction performs an atomic compare-and-exchange on 16-byte values.This requirement is met by all modern processors and is generally only an issue with certain Core 2 and earlier processors. In fact, the same features are required to run 64-bit Windows 8.1.









Aida 32 bit